Medical Coder Job Duties

Medical coders work on the forefront of the billing systems for Coleraine MN private practices and healthcare organizations. Coders have the responsibility to analyze the treatment records of patients and convert all services provided into universal codes. These services can be for medical, diagnosis or dental procedures, or any equipment or medical supplies used. There are various codes that are utilized in the conversion, including:

  • CPT codes (Current Procedural Terminology).
  • ICD codes (International Classification of Diseases).
  • HCPCS codes (Healthcare Common Procedure Coding).

Medical coders rely on information from sources such as nursing and physician notes, patient charts, and radiology and lab reports. Coders must know not only what total services were provided for accuracy, but must have a working knowledge of all private payer and government rules that impact coding as well. Incorrectly coded claims may lead to services not being covered, services being paid at a reduced rate, or the physician or facility being penalized for improper or fraudulent billing. Since improper coding can literally cost Coleraine MN physicians and medical facilities many thousands of dollars in revenue every year, a good medical coder is an important asset to the healthcare team. They can operate in every type of healthcare facility, including private practices, hospitals, clinics and critical care centers. It is not unusual for seasoned medical coders to operate at home as an offsite employee or an independent contractor.

Medical Biller Job Duties

Coleraine MN medical billers collect revenueAs crucial as the medical coder’s role is, it would be for naught without the collaboration of the medical biller whose labors produce revenue. Medical billing clerks are extremely important to Coleraine MN healthcare organizations and are practically responsible for keeping them in business. Often the coder and biller may be the same man or woman within a medical facility, but they can also be two individual specialists. Once the coder has completed his or her task, the biller uses the codes furnished to complete and submit claim forms to insurance carriers, Medicaid or Medicare. After they have been adjusted by the applicable organization, patients can then be charged for deductibles and additional out of pocket costs. On a routine basis, a medical billing professional can also do any of the following:

  • Confirm health insurance benefits for patients and help them with billing questions or concerns
  • Check on patient claims submitted and appeal any that have been denied
  • Act as an intermediary between the healthcare provider, the insurance companies and the patients for proper claim settlement
  • Generate and manage Accounts Receivables reports
  • Generate and handle unpaid patient collections accounts

Medical billing clerks not only are employed by private practices, but also Coleraine MN hospitals, urgent care facilities, medical groups or nursing homes. They may work in any type of medical facility that relies on the revenues generated from billing third party payers and patients.

Medical Coding and Billing Online Instruction and Certification

Coleraine MN patients are billed for medical treatmentIt’s important that you get your training from a reputable school, whether it’s a technical school, vocational school or community college. Even though it is not a requirement in many cases to earn a professional certification, the program you select should be accredited (more on the advantages of accreditation later). Most programs only require that you have either a high school diploma or a GED to be eligible. The fastest way to becoming either a medical coder or biller (or both) is to earn a certificate, which generally takes about 1 year to complete. An Associate Degree is also an option for a more expansive education, which for almost all programs requires 2 years of studies. Bachelor’s Degrees for medical billing and coding are not widely available. After your training has been completed, although not required in most states, you might want to acquire a professional certification. Certification is an effective method for those new to the field to show prospective employers that they are not only qualified but dedicated to their career. Some of the organizations that provide certifications are:

  • American Academy of Professional Coders (AAPC).
  • Board of Medical Specialty Coding (BMSC).
  • The Professional Association of Healthcare Coding Specialists (PAHCS).
  • American Health Information Management Association (AHIMA).

Completing an accredited medical billing and coding course, together with attaining a professional certification, are the best ways to advance your new career and succeed in the rapid growing medical care field.

Coleraine, Minnesota

According to the United States Census Bureau, the city has a total area of 16.64 square miles (43.10 km2), of which 16.13 square miles (41.78 km2) is land and 0.51 square miles (1.32 km2) is water.[1]

As of the census[2] of 2010, there were 1,970 people, 768 households, and 550 families residing in the city. The population density was 122.1 inhabitants per square mile (47.1/km2). There were 831 housing units at an average density of 51.5 per square mile (19.9/km2). The racial makeup of the city was 95.4% White, 0.4% African American, 1.5% Native American, 0.2% Asian, 0.2% from other races, and 2.4%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 1.4% of the population.

There were 768 households of which 34.4%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 56.0% were married couples living together, 9.5% had a female householder with no husband present, 6.1% had a male householder with no wife present, and 28.4% were non-families. 22.9% of all households were made up of individuals and 8.7%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.54 and the average family size was 2.94.
